Best Ever Split Pea Soup

This tasty split pea soup recipe is made with dried yellow and green split peas. It's simple to make and really sticks to your ribs, even with no ham!

Preparation Time
20 mins
Cooking Time
2 hr 40 mins
Total Time
3 hr
Calories
133 Calories

Recipe Instructions

Step 1
Heat oil in a Dutch oven over medium heat. Add onion, carrot, celery, and garlic; cook and stir until onion is translucent,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ir in broth, split peas, and seasoning blend; cover and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at and simmer, stirring frequently, until peas are tender, about 2 1/2 hours. Purée with an immersion blender and serve.

Ingredients

  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 cups chopped onion
  • 2 cups chopped carrot
  • 1 cup yellow split peas
  • 2 cups finely chopped celery
  • 1 cup green split peas
  • 8 cups fat-free chicken broth
  • 1.5 teaspoons salt-free seasoning blend (such as Mrs. Dash®)
  • 1.5 teaspoons minced garlic
